Florida City DUI Incidents
Florida City, FL, located in Miami-Dade County, has seen a concerning number of DUI incidents in recent years. The Department of Transportation (DOT) in Florida has been actively working to reduce these numbers by increasing awareness and implementing stricter enforcement measures. In 2023, Miami-Dade County reported over 1,500 DUI-related accidents, with Florida City contributing to a significant portion of these cases. The state of Florida, recognizing the impact of impaired driving, has launched several initiatives to educate the public and improve road safety. These efforts include collaborating with local law enforcement agencies and community organizations to promote responsible driving and reduce DUI rates across the Sunshine State. Despite these efforts, DUI incidents continue to pose a serious threat to the safety of Florida City residents and motorists statewide.
Drug-Involved Accidents in Miami-Dade County
Drug-involved accidents have been a cause for concern in Miami-Dade County, where Florida City is located. The Florida Department of Transportation (FDOT) has reported a noticeable increase in collisions involving drugs such as opioids and cocaine. In 2023, Miami-Dade County recorded over 1,200 drug-related traffic incidents, signaling a need for enhanced preventive measures. This uptick in drug-involved crashes has prompted Florida state officials to intensify their focus on drug education and enforcement. The FDOT is collaborating with public health entities and law enforcement to tackle the issue head-on by promoting safer driving practices and implementing comprehensive rehabilitation programs. Despite these interventions, the challenge remains significant as the state of Florida strives to minimize the occurrence of drug-related accidents and protect its residents.
Marijuana-Related Accidents in Florida City
The rise in marijuana usage following legalization trends has also seen an increase in marijuana-related accidents in Florida City, FL, part of Miami-Dade County. In 2023, marijuana was identified as a contributing factor in approximately 400 traffic accidents within the county. The link between marijuana impairment and driving safety continues to be studied, with the Florida Department of Transportation acknowledging the complexities of measuring impairment levels. Nonetheless, Florida's authorities are leveraging awareness campaigns and targeted law enforcement operations to address marijuana-related driving incidents. The state aims to educate Florida drivers on the potential risks associated with marijuana impairment and its impact on road safety. Through these proactive efforts, Florida City and the broader region hope to achieve a reduction in accidents and promote a more secure driving environment.
